Abstract:
【Objective】 To screen out the yield index and drought resistance of rapeseed varieties with strong drought resistance, so as to lay a foundation for breeding drought resistance varieties. 【Methods】 Under the conditions of dry-land, the agronomic traits of the materials were first compared to analyze whether there was any difference between the materials. Secondly, the drought resistance identification yield index (DRC, SSI, DRI, DI) of the materials. Comparative analyses of index, DRI and DI were carried out. Finally, suitable drought resistance identification yield indicators were selected, and rapeseed varieties with strong drought resistance were screened in the tested materials. 【Results】 The results showed that the plant height and yield of 25 tested rapeseed varieties under different drought stresses decreased to varying degrees, and the differences among the materials were significant. Among the drought resistance identification yield indicators, (1) DRC and SSI could be used to evaluate the stability of the variety, but cannot reflect the yield of the dry land; (2) The DRI did not only investigate the yield stability of rape varieties, but also took into account the dryland yield, and compared with the average yield of the same group of dryland, which was more suitable for the identification of drought resistance of rapeseed varieties. (3) The revision formula of DI utilized the yield of the control varieties, which was the same as the trend of drought resistance ability of the tested rape varieties reflected by the DRI. By taking into account the absolute yield and drought resistance coefficient of the tested varieties in dryland and water land, the high yield and drought resistance of the tested varieties were evaluated. Therefore, the DRI and DI were suitable for the comprehensive drought resistance identification of rapeseed varieties. On this basis, among the three types of test materials, according to the DRI, DI and the two habitats (drought-land and water-land), Qingza 12, Qingza 11, Dalajie, Yao 328-331 and Dahuang were selected. 【Conclusion】 The DRI and DI of rapeseed drought resistance varieties are suitable for comprehensive evaluation and identification of drought resistance. The drought resistance varieties selected from 25 rapeseed resources based on screening indicators are Qingza 12, Qingza 11, Dalajie, Yao 328-331 and Dahuang.
